Key Information to Consider

Before we delve into the specific details of car insurance costs in Utah, it’s important to highlight some key information that can significantly impact your premiums. Understanding these factors will allow you to better navigate the car insurance landscape in Utah:

  • Your driving record: Your driving history has a direct impact on your car insurance rates. If you have a clean driving record with no accidents or violations, you are likely to secure lower premium rates.
  • Credit score: In Utah, your credit score can also influence your car insurance costs. Insurers consider individuals with higher credit scores to be less risky, resulting in potentially lower premium rates.
  • Vehicle type: The type of vehicle you drive can affect your insurance costs. Newer or more expensive vehicles generally have higher insurance premiums due to increased repair and replacement costs.
  • Age and gender: Younger drivers typically face higher insurance rates compared to older, more experienced drivers. Additionally, gender can also be a determining factor, as statistics show that certain age and gender demographics are more prone to accidents on the road.

Analyzing Car Insurance Rates by City in Utah

In Utah, car insurance rates can vary depending on the city you reside in. Factors such as population density, crime rates, and local traffic conditions can influence premiums. It’s important to explore insurance rates specific to your city or town to get an accurate estimate of the costs you may face.

Understanding Average Car Insurance Costs by Age and Gender in Utah

Age and gender play significant roles in determining car insurance costs in Utah. Younger drivers, especially teenagers, tend to have higher insurance rates due to their lack of driving experience. Additionally, certain age and gender demographics may statistically exhibit higher risk factors. However, it’s important to note that insurance companies in Utah are prohibited from using gender as a primary factor in determining insurance premiums.

Factors to Consider for Young Drivers in Utah

If you are a young driver in Utah, there are specific factors that can impact your car insurance costs. Completing a driver’s education course or maintaining good grades can often lead to discounts. Additionally, the type of vehicle you drive and your chosen coverage limits can also affect your premium rates. Exploring these factors and discussing them with your insurance provider can help you find ways to lower your insurance costs.

The Impact of Driving Record on Car Insurance Costs in Utah

In Utah, a clean driving record can significantly impact your car insurance costs. Insurance companies consider drivers with a history of accidents or traffic violations to be higher risk. Therefore, if you have a history of incidents, you may face higher premiums. On the other hand, maintaining a clean driving record can help you enjoy more affordable car insurance rates.

Car Insurance Rates in Utah Based on Credit Tier

In Utah, your credit score also plays a role in determining your car insurance rates. Insurers often consider individuals with higher credit scores to be more responsible and less likely to file claims. Therefore, those with excellent credit may receive lower premium rates compared to those with poor credit. Regularly monitoring and improving your credit score can help lower your car insurance costs over time. Car Insurance Rates in Utah by Vehicle Type

As mentioned earlier, the type of vehicle you drive can impact your car insurance costs in Utah. Insurance providers assess the risk associated with each type of vehicle and adjust premiums accordingly. For example, sports cars or vehicles with high theft rates may attract higher insurance rates due to increased risk factors. Choosing a vehicle that aligns with your budget and insurance needs can help you manage your car insurance costs more effectively.

Money-Saving Tips for Car Insurance in Utah

Saving money on your car insurance is always a priority. Here are some valuable tips to help you reduce your insurance costs in Utah:

  1. Shop around: Compare rates from different insurance providers to find the best coverage at the most affordable price.
  2. Bundle your policies: Many insurance companies offer discounts if you bundle your car insurance with other policies, such as homeowners or renters insurance.
  3. Increase deductibles: Raising your deductibles can lower your premium rates. However, make sure you choose deductibles that you can comfortably afford in the event of a claim.
  4. Take advantage of discounts: Many insurance companies offer various discounts, such as safe driving discounts, good student discounts, or discounts for installing safety features in your vehicle.
  5. Consider usage-based insurance: Usage-based insurance programs monitor your driving habits and can potentially save you money if you prove to be a safe driver.

Calculating Your Monthly Car Insurance Payment in Utah

Calculating your monthly car insurance payment in Utah is relatively straightforward. Begin by selecting a few insurance providers and obtaining quotes based on your requirements. Compare the coverage options, deductibles, and premiums offered by each insurer. Once you have identified the most suitable policy for your needs, divide the annual premium by 12 to determine your monthly payment. Remember to factor in any additional fees or discounts that may apply.
